Abstract

Official abstract text for this publication.

A hybrid vehicle in which at least two shift ranges can be selected for a single running direction includes an engine, a motor generator, an EHC raising the temperature of a catalyst for cleaning up an exhaust gas from the engine, and an ECU. While the vehicle is running, if the engine is stopped and, of the two shift ranges, a shift range where larger decelerating force is produced by regenerative braking of the motor generator has been selected, the ECU causes the EHC to raise the temperature of the catalyst using electric power generated by the motor generator.

First claim

Opening claim text (preview).

The invention claimed is: 1. A vehicle in which at least two shift ranges can be selected for a single running direction, comprising: an internal combustion engine; a rotating electric machine coupled to a driving wheel of said vehicle, the rotating electric machine producing driving force for causing said vehicle to run, and being capable of generating electric power by rotary force of said driving wheel; a warming-up device configured to raise a temperature of a catalyst for…
